The Role of Funerals in Remembering a Loved One
A funeral service is a significant way to celebrate a loved one’s life. Whether held in a faith-based setting, a memorial hall, or an open space, a traditional funeral allows relatives to come together, remember the good times, and seek solace. Many services include spoken words, hymns, and traditions that reflect personal or religious practices.

Why Burial Remains a Traditional Choice
For many, laying to rest is a deeply rooted practice that provides a permanent site to remember a loved one. Whether in a burial ground, a family plot, or a memorial garden, burial offers a sense of continuity and bond. Some families prefer classic burial options, while others may opt for eco-friendly alternatives, such as environmentally friendly coffins.

Cremation: A Flexible and Meaningful Alternative
In recent years, cremation has become an increasingly chosen option due to its flexibility and affordability. Families who choose cremation can still hold a full funeral service beforehand or plan a remembrance event at a later date. The memorial remains can be preserved in a memorial container, released in nature, or even turned into lasting mementos.
